The as-welded microstructure of laser-welded Ti-6Al-4V is characterized as a function of CO2 key-hole mode laser welding speed. Martensitic alpha' is the predominant phase, with some alpha and retained beta. Phase transformation is affected by the cooling rate through laser welding speed. A higher welding speed of 1.6 to 2.0 m/min produced more martensite alpha' and less retained beta in the welds. 1.4 m/min welding speed produced small amounts of alpha, besides the martensite alpha'. A trace of delta titanium hydride phase seems to have formed in the weld fusion zone. Moire fringes are a common feature in the TEM microstructure, due to abundance of multi-phase interfaces. Tensile twins and clusters of dislocations indicate that plastic deformation has happened in the as-welded microstructure, indicating the local stress levels to be approaching the yield stress on-cooling during laser welding.
